Comments: Wow, I just stumbled on this gem of a photo. Mtn. Project surprises again. I climbed a bunch with Ken back in the '70s. He was a great guy , super solid and calm when the chips were down. We climbed the Higher Cathedral Spire in winter and made what was my first El Cap attempt in winter. We were lucky to survive the ice chunk (tv to refrigerator sized pieces) bombardment. I was just a kid but he, at 11 yrs. older, was a man. I looked up to him and would have followed him anywhere. He died way ... more >>

Location: NV : Red Rock : Black Velvet Canyon : Black Velvet Wall : Rock Warrior (5.10b R) By: D. Evans When: Feb 17, 2011 | view comment >> |
Comments: Todd Gordon and I did what I believe was possibly the second ascent in April 1985. I remember the first two pitches as tricky. We continued to the top of Black Velvet Peak for 15 pitches, many of them after dark. We got down to the car around midnight to find our friend Holly asleep and dinner very cold. She was more annoyed than worried. It was a long day.
